2024-11-04 — Rotated the signing key used by the Fennick partition scheduler after the monthly table partitioning job moved to the new orchestrator. Partitions for events_raw now roll over at 00:00 UTC on the 1st. No action needed unless partition creation fails; alerts route to on-call. The new deploy key is below.

signing key of bagap-yawep = bky13_TbfT6ZMUoGJo2

Subject: Cut-over complete — N+1 fix live

Team,

The Cindervale GraphQL cut-over finished last night. The batching dataloader replaced per-row resolver fetches; database query volume on the catalog endpoint is down roughly 90%. No rollbacks needed. One caveat: the legacy resolver path is still present behind a flag and will be removed next sprint — don't build against it. Monitoring showed stable p95 latency through the morning peak. Staging and production are now aligned. The production service is running with the following configuration.

settings of kajef-hafog:
[ralys]
team = holiel
access_code = ac_fa834c
owner = noviel.gilion
host = ralys.halixlabs.test
port = 9300
peer = raldor.ordindata.local
salt = e78ca807
pin = 4961

The licensing dispute with Calder Mint Software remains the principal legal matter this quarter. Counsel advises that our documentation of the original grant is strong, but the counterclaim regarding derivative modules carries moderate risk. Mediation is scheduled for early next quarter, and we have reserved contingency funds accordingly. Product release timelines are unaffected for now, though marketing language has been adjusted as a precaution. The confidential note on related business plans appears below.

confidential, baweg-tahop: The steering committee signed off on a budget of $1.4 million for Project Gordor. The renewal with Elioxix Holdings closes at $31.7 million a year, 60 percent below the last contract.